Transaction 57aa2f8a8ab6f4dea323aeff5bbf19c7e90e0af9450e03cfed39cf679d5eb75e

1 Input
2 Outputs
  • 57aa2f8a8ab6f4dea323aeff5bbf19c7e90e0af9450e03cfed39cf679d5eb75e:0
  • value  47234
    address  13sfkVDqmRq16CqVMrvBzajZBFDHtgMJCo
  • 57aa2f8a8ab6f4dea323aeff5bbf19c7e90e0af9450e03cfed39cf679d5eb75e:1
  • value  507533381
    address  3Mxmh4AnjF5y6dAMR5UxnQBPG3Tfuha7jN